A home for my ZL1
Here's my garage. It includes a RaceDeck freeflow floor and diamond cut aluminum wall panels, as well as a Craftsman table/stools (not shown in photo) and Gladiator cabinets. I've since installed some nice hanging lights. It's in desperate need of wall art, but that's on my "winter agenda". Lol... Perhaps a few neon signs, banners, etc.

Front half of the barn...the shop. Was my race shop that I built and raced Dirt Late Models and my kids Quarter Midgets out of for 23 years. Not in the picture are the sheet metal break, welders, torches, etc. The front is all insulated, heated (stays at 40 degrees all winter too!), Cable TV, stereo system, etc. The other side of the wall is the back half of the barn...unheated. That is for storage of other toys like tractors and quads! And my HD2500 Duramax...she has to live in the cold during the winter. LOL
